After soaring to eight goals the game before, Swansea was a bit more limited in their contest on Friday. They came up short against the Powdersville Patriots, falling 5-0. While losing is never fun, Swansea can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' South Carolina soccer rankings (they are ranked 43rd, while Powdersville are ranked eighth).
Swansea's loss dropped their record down to 10-5. As for Powdersville,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 16-1.
Swansea will have a little extra prep time after the defeat as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Blythewood at 7:00 p.m. on the 22nd. Swansea will need to watch out since Blythewood have now posted at least four goals in their last four matches. As for Powdersville, they have already played their next game, a 2-0 victory against St. Joseph's Catholic on the 14th.
